Output 86427d6c0de15fe6553c1f8891c7fc3b3f82027d5edc40f7334a2e6e8314516b:1

value
214600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df4c0753f5def3bd9558d5952960e06b176938af OP_EQUAL
address
3N3hgtC2Mg81AXoesb41xqGZWTzXw28pjN
transaction
86427d6c0de15fe6553c1f8891c7fc3b3f82027d5edc40f7334a2e6e8314516b
confirmations
227824
spent
true